Grasping the Cost of Professional Tree Service
Determining the expense of professional tree service can sometimes be a bit involved. Several factors influence the final figure, such as the size and state of the tree, the type of work required, and your regional location. A simple topping might cost a few hundred dollars, while removing a large, mature tree could easily run into the thousands. It's always best to obtain bids from several reputable arborists before making a decision.

Your Guide to Affordable Tree Services
Maintaining the wellbeing of your trees doesn't have to break the bank. With some planning and research, you can find budget-friendly tree services that fulfill your needs without compromising quality.
- First consider asking for quotes from multiple companies. This will give you a good idea of the typical costs in your area.
- Don't be hesitant to negotiate prices with service providers. They may be willing to offer a deal if you book your services in advance or bundle multiple services together.
- Investigate tree care companies that focus on in homeowner services. They often offer more competitive pricing than larger, business-focused companies.
Bear in mind that the cheapest option isn't always the best. It's important to select a company that is licensed and has a favorable reputation.
